Clear Structure for Statewide and City Pages
A website can serve more than one market, but each page needs a clear role. This page supports statewide searches, while each city page focuses on its own local audience.
This structure helps users find the right local information and helps search engines connect your business with high-intent searches for Web Design Colorado.
Websites Built Around Your Local Market
Some businesses only need one strong service area page. Others need city pages for their most important markets.
We help plan which pages should exist, what each page should target, and how they should link together. The goal is not more pages. The goal is a cleaner structure that supports the right searches.
